Answer:
C) The expected value is -$40, so the man should not buy the warranty.
Step-by-step explanation:
The total cost to the man is expected to be the total of the amount he pays for the warranty and any amounts he gets because he has the warranty ...
-$100 +600×0.10 +0×0.90 = -$40
The expected value of the warranty is -$40. Based on that alone, the man should decide not to buy it.
____
<em>Comment on warranties</em>
The expected value of a warranty to the buyer is <em>always negative</em>. That is how warranty companies make their money. Clearly, <em>expected value</em> is not the only criterion that should be considered.

The next 4 terms are 375, 75, 15 and 3
<h3>How to determine the next 4 terms?</h3>
The sequence is given as:
234375, 46875, 9375, 1875...
Notice that the current term of the sequence is 1/5 of the previous term.
So, the next four terms are:
Next 1 = 1/5 * 1875 = 375
Next 2 = 1/5 * 375 = 75
Next 3 = 1/5 * 75 = 15
Next 4 = 1/5 * 15 = 3
Hence, the next 4 terms are 375, 75, 15 and 3
